EN 10269 Grade C35E – High-Performance Quenched & Tempered Steel for Automotive & Machinery

Steel C35E is suitable for slightly higher loaded components in vehicle and machine engineering which have larger dimensions (large forged parts) and more complex forms as well as higher demands on constancy of properties and surface integrity (e.g. gearbox parts, crankshafts). Lowest working temperature -25 °C, good creep behavior up to 480 °C The steel as a bright steel product is used in the form of rods, bright, straight, in different conditions (see DIN EN 10277 : 1999-10). Further application for mounting elements at increased temperatures.
